func ValidateConfigFile(path string, content string) error {
if err := ValidateConfigFilename(path); err != nil {
return err
}
return ValidateConfigContent(content)
}
func ValidateConfigFileBytes(path string, content []byte) error {
if err := ValidateConfigFilename(path); err != nil {
return err
}
return ValidateConfigContentBytes(content)
}
func ValidateConfigFilename(path string) error {
confPath := filepath.Clean(nginx.GetConfPath())
cleanPath := filepath.Clean(path)
if !helper.IsUnderDirectory(cleanPath, confPath) {
return cosy.WrapErrorWithParams(ErrPathIsNotUnderTheNginxConfDir, cleanPath, confPath)
}
baseName := filepath.Base(cleanPath)
if baseName == "." || baseName == string(filepath.Separator) || baseName == "" {
return cosy.WrapErrorWithParams(ErrConfigFilenameNotAllowed, baseName)
}
lowerBaseName := strings.ToLower(baseName)
if strings.ToLower(filepath.Ext(baseName)) == ".conf" {
return nil
}
if _, ok := allowedConfigBaseNames[lowerBaseName]; ok {
return nil
}
relativePath, err := filepath.Rel(confPath, cleanPath)
if err != nil {
return cosy.WrapErrorWithParams(ErrConfigFilenameNotAllowed, baseName)
}
segments := strings.Split(filepath.ToSlash(relativePath), "/")
if len(segments) == 0 {
return cosy.WrapErrorWithParams(ErrConfigFilenameNotAllowed, baseName)
}
firstSegment := strings.ToLower(segments[0])
if _, ok := managedConfigDirs[firstSegment]; ok {
ext := strings.ToLower(filepath.Ext(baseName))
if ext == "" {
return nil
}
if _, blocked := blockedManagedConfigExtensions[ext]; blocked {
return cosy.WrapErrorWithParams(ErrConfigFilenameNotAllowed, baseName)
}
return nil
}
return cosy.WrapErrorWithParams(ErrConfigFilenameNotAllowed, baseName)
}
func ValidateConfigContent(content string) error {
return ValidateConfigContentBytes([]byte(content))
}
func ValidateConfigContentBytes(content []byte) error {
if !utf8.Valid(content) {
return ErrConfigContentMustBeUTF8Text
}
for remaining := content; len(remaining) > 0; {
r, size := utf8.DecodeRune(remaining)
if unicode.IsControl(r) && r != '\n' && r != '\r' && r != '\t' {
return ErrConfigContentHasControlChars
}
remaining = remaining[size:]
}
if err := ValidateConfigDirectives(content); err != nil {
return err
}
return nil
}
func ValidateConfigDirectives(content []byte) error {
for _, line := range bytes.Split(content, []byte("\n")) {
trimmed := strings.TrimSpace(string(line))
if trimmed == "" || strings.HasPrefix(trimmed, "#") {
continue
}
directive := firstDirectiveToken(trimmed)
if directive == "" {
continue
}
if directive == "user" && configuresRootWorkers(trimmed) {
return cosy.WrapErrorWithParams(ErrConfigDirectiveNotAllowed, "user root")
}
if directive == "load_module" && loadsRestrictedDynamicModule(trimmed) {
return cosy.WrapErrorWithParams(ErrConfigDirectiveNotAllowed, "load_module")
}
if _, blocked := blockedConfigDirectives[directive]; blocked {
return cosy.WrapErrorWithParams(ErrConfigDirectiveNotAllowed, directive)
}
}
return nil
}
func firstDirectiveToken(line string) string {
end := 0
for end < len(line) {
ch := line[end]
if (ch >= 'a' && ch <= 'z') || (ch >= 'A' && ch <= 'Z') || ch == '_' {
end++
continue
}
break
}
if end == 0 {
return ""
}
return strings.ToLower(line[:end])
}
func configuresRootWorkers(line string) bool {
fields := strings.Fields(line)
if len(fields) < 2 {
return false
}
userValue := strings.Trim(fields[1], ";\"'")
return strings.EqualFold(userValue, "root")
}
func loadsRestrictedDynamicModule(line string) bool {
lowerLine := strings.ToLower(line)
for _, moduleName := range blockedDynamicModules {
if strings.Contains(lowerLine, moduleName) {
return true
}
}
return false
}
